One thing I ask myself when getting rid of something is "how much would it cost me to replace this if I miss it later?" In your case, as in a lot of cases, what you spent years ago would probably not be nearly as expensive today.
I have had clients that actually want to hang onto boxes of old brochures even after we have designed and printed something completely new and much better for where their business is currently. What they say is "but I spent $xxx.xx on these" and what I hear is "I don't want to throw away money" and the reality is that there is no money there to throw away - only a product that is no longer useful to them that's taking up space. :)
